Bible verses about "holiness" | Coverdale

Leviticus 20:26

26 Therfore shall ye be holy vnto me: for I the LORDE am holy, which haue separated you fro the nacions, that ye shulde be myne.

Leviticus 19:2

2 Speake to the whole congregacion of the children of Israel, and saye vnto them: Ye shall be holy, for I am holy, euen the LORDE youre God.

Isaiah 35:8

8 There shalbe footpathes & comon stretes, this shalbe called the holywaye. No vnclene person shal go thorow it, for the LORDE himself shal go with the that waye, and the ignoraut shal not erre.

1 Thessalonians 5:23

23 The very God of peace sanctifye you thorow out. And I praye God, that youre whole sprete, soule & body be kepte blameles vnto ye comynge of oure LORDE Iesus Christ.

1 Corinthians 6:19

19 Or knowe ye not that youre body is the temple of the holy goost? Whom ye haue of God, and are not youre awne?

Philippians 4:8

8 Furthermore brethren, whatsoeuer thinges are true, whatsoeuer thinges are honest, what soeuer thinges are iust, what so euer thinges are pure, what soeuer thinges pertayne to loue, whatsoeuer thinges are of honest reporte: yf there be eny vertuous thinge, yf there be eny laudable thinge,

1 Thessalonians 4:7

7 For God hath not called vs to vnclennesse, but vnto holynes.

2 Timothy 2:21

21 But yf a man pourge himselfe from soch felowes, he shalbe a vessell sanctified vnto honoure, mete for the LORDE, and prepared vnto all good workes.

1 Peter 2:9

9 But ye are that chosen generacion, that kyngly presthode, that holy nacion, that peculier people, yt ye shulde shewe the vertues of him, which hath called you out of darknesse in to his maruelous lighte:

Hebrews 12:14

14 Folowe after peace with all men, and holynes, without the which no man shal se the LORDE,

2 Corinthians 7:1

1 Seynge now that we haue soch promyses (dearly beloued) let vs clense oureselues from all fylthynes of the flesh and sprete, and growe vp to full holynes in ye feare of God.

1 John 3:6-10

6 Who so euer abydeth in him, synneth not: who soeuer synneth, hath not sene him nether knowne him. 7 Babes, let noman disceaue you. He that doeth righteousnes, is righteous, euen as he is righteous. 8 He that commytteth synne, is of the deuell: for the deuell synneth sence ye begynnynge. For this purpose appeared the sonne of God, to lowse the workes of the deuell. 9 Who so euer is borne of God, synneth not: for his sede remayneth in him, & he ca not synne, because he is borne of God. 10 By this are the children of God knowne & the children of the deuell. Who so euer doeth not righteousnes, is not of God, nether he thath loueth not his brother.

1 Peter 1:14-16

14 as obedient childre, not fasshionynge youre selues to yor olde lustes of ignoraunce: 15 but as he which hath called you is holy, eue so be ye holy also in all youre conuersacion: 16 for it it wrytte: Be ye holy, for I am holy.
